About Bitcoin Cash

Bitcoin Cash (BCH) is a peer-to-peer electronic cash system that aims to become sound global money with fast payments, micro fees, privacy, and high transaction capacity (big blocks). With a limited total supply of 21 million coins, Bitcoin Cash is provably scarce and, like physical cash, can be easily spent.

About Lombard Staked BTC

LBTC is a liquid Bitcoin asset created by Lombard that connects Bitcoin to decentralized finance. Backed 1:1 by BTC, it allows holders to earn Babylon staking yield while using their Bitcoin across DeFi activities such as trading, lending, borrowing, and yield farming through a natively cross-chain design.
